American Leadership Forum
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2020 | 976,890 | 936,317 | 40,573 | 42.8 | 51% |
| 2021 | 1,506,683 | 1,327,100 | 179,583 | 31.0 | 36% |
| 2022 | 1,518,384 | 1,368,011 | 150,373 | 26.9 | 35% |
| 2023 | 1,573,957 | 1,696,578 | −122,621 | 23.0 | 31%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ization spent $122,621 more than it brought in. Its reserves stood at about 23 months of spending, down from 42.8 in 2020. Staff pay was 31% of spending. $2,022,707 of its net assets are donor-restricted.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
